10.1.7 Climatic Stress Tests
Ambient
Temperatures
Standards: IEC 60255–6
recommended operating temperature –5 °C to +55 °C (+23 °F to +131 °F)
if max. half of the inputs and outputs are subjected
to the max. permissible values
recommended operating temperature –5 °C to +40 °C (+23 °F to +104 °F)
if all inputs and outputs are subjected
to the max. permissible values
limiting temporary (transient) 20 °C to +70 °C
operating temperature (–4 °F to 158 °F)
in quiescent state, i.e. no pick-up and no
indications
limiting temperature during storage –25 °C to +55 °C (–13 °F to 131 °F)
limiting temperature during transport 25 °C to +70 °C (–13 °F to 158 °F)
Storage and transport of the device with factory packaging!
Humidity Permissible humidity mean value p. year 75 % relative humidity
on 56 days per year up to 93 % relative
humidity; condensation not permissible!
It is recommended that all devices are installed such that they are not exposed to di-
rect sunlight, nor subject to large fluctuations in temperature that may cause conden-
sation to occur.
10.1.8 Service Conditions
The device is designed for use in an industrial environment or an electrical utility en-
vironment, for installation in standard relay rooms and compartments so that proper
installation and elect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) is ensured. In addition, the follow-
ing are recommended:
All contactors and relays that operate in the same cubicle, cabinet, or relay panel
as the numerical protective device should, as a rule, be equipped with suitable
surge suppression components.
For substations with operating voltages of 100 kV and above, all external cables
should be shielded with a conductive shield grounded at both ends. The shield must
be capable of carrying the fault currents that could occur. For substations with lower
operating voltages, no special measures are normally required.
